Updating a Bitbucket Cloud Configuration Source Provider

Update a Bitbucket Cloud configuration source provider in Resource Manager.

    1. Open the navigation menu and click Developer Services. Under Resource Manager, click Configuration Source Providers.
    2. On the Configuration source providers page, select the compartment that contains the configuration source provider that you want.
    3. Click the name of the configuration source provider that you want.
      The value in the Type column indicates the configuration source provider type.
    4. Click Edit.
    5. To change the connection details, in the Edit configuration source provider panel, edit one or more of the following values:
      • To use a different private endpoint, select the endpoint and then select an SSL certificate. This option is available when the configuration source provider was created with a private endpoint.
      • Server URL: The Bitbucket Cloud service endpoint.
      • Vault: Vault service where the secret is stored.
      • Secret: Secret for authorization.
    6. Optionally change the compartment, name, or description.
    7. Click Save changes.
  • Use the oci resource-manager configuration-source-provider update-bitbucket-cloud-username-app-password-provider command and required parameters to update a configuration source provider from Bitbucket Cloud.

    oci resource-manager configuration-source-provider update-bitbucket-cloud-username-app-password-provider --configuration-source-provider-id <configuration_source_provider_OCID>

    For a complete list of parameters and values for CLI commands, see the Command Line Reference for Resource Manager.

  • Run the UpdateConfigurationSourceProvider operation to update a configuration source provider that uses Bitbucket Cloud.

    For an example of the configSourceProviderType part of the request, see UpdateBitbucketCloudUsernameAppPasswordConfigurationSourceProviderDetails.
